news 2026/4/23 13:51:20

Mitsuba Blender插件完全指南:从入门到精通的7个关键环节

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Mitsuba Blender插件完全指南:从入门到精通的7个关键环节

Mitsuba Blender插件完全指南:从入门到精通的7个关键环节

【免费下载链接】mitsuba-blenderMitsuba integration add-on for Blender项目地址: https://gitcode.com/gh_mirrors/mi/mitsuba-blender

一、认知篇:揭开Mitsuba Blender插件的神秘面纱

Mitsuba Blender插件是一款将Mitsuba渲染器集成到Blender中的强大工具,它就像一座桥梁,让你在熟悉的Blender界面中就能使用业界领先的物理渲染技术。想象一下,你在Blender这个创意工厂里,Mitsuba插件就是那个能把你的创意打造成极致逼真作品的超级引擎。通过它,你可以轻松实现专业级的物理渲染效果,让你的3D作品焕发出前所未有的真实感。

1. 插件核心价值解析

Mitsuba Blender插件的核心价值在于它实现了Mitsuba渲染器与Blender的无缝对接。Mitsuba渲染器以其高精度的物理渲染而闻名,而Blender则是一款功能强大的3D创作软件。这款插件将两者结合,让用户无需在不同软件之间来回切换,就能享受到顶级的渲染效果。对于有一定3D设计基础,想要提升作品渲染质量的用户来说,它是一个不可或缺的工具。

2. 与同类工具的对比优势

对比项目Mitsuba Blender插件其他渲染插件
物理渲染精度高,基于先进的物理模型中等,部分依赖经验参数
材质系统完整的物理材质支持,种类丰富基础材质为主,复杂材质需手动调整
渲染速度优化较好,兼顾质量与速度部分插件速度较慢或质量一般
Blender集成度深度集成,操作流程自然集成度参差不齐,部分操作繁琐

二、实践篇:从零开始的插件上手之旅

3. 插件获取与安装全流程

目标:成功将Mitsuba Blender插件安装到Blender中并启用。操作

  1. 打开终端,执行以下命令克隆插件仓库:git clone https://gitcode.com/gh_mirrors/mi/mitsuba-blender
  2. 打开Blender软件,进入“编辑”菜单,选择“偏好设置”,再点击“插件”选项。
  3. 点击“安装”按钮,在弹出的文件选择窗口中,导航到克隆下来的mitsuba-blender文件夹,选择其中的mitsuba-blender/__init__.py文件。
  4. 安装完成后,在插件列表中找到Mitsuba插件,勾选其前方的复选框以启用插件。预期结果:插件成功安装并启用,在Blender的相关面板中能看到Mitsuba的相关选项。

4. 初始配置与环境搭建

目标:完成Mitsuba渲染器路径配置,确保插件能正常调用渲染功能。操作

  1. 在Blender的偏好设置中,找到Mitsuba插件的设置选项。
  2. 在设置中找到“Mitsuba路径”配置项,点击“浏览”按钮,选择你电脑上Mitsuba渲染器的安装路径。如果你还没有安装Mitsuba,可以从官方网站下载预编译版本并安装。
  3. 配置完成后,点击“保存用户设置”以保存配置。预期结果:插件成功识别Mitsuba渲染器路径,无报错提示。

三、深化篇:功能探索与问题解决

5. 核心特性与应用场景全解析

核心特性应用场景
导体材质:模拟金属表面的物理特性,包括高光、反射等用于制作金属制品,如首饰、器械、汽车零件等,展现真实的金属质感
塑料材质:实现真实的塑料渲染效果,可调整粗糙度、颜色等参数适用于各种塑料制品,如玩具、日常用品、电子产品外壳等
玻璃材质:精确的光线折射和反射计算,支持不同折射率设置用于制作玻璃杯、窗户、透镜等透明或半透明物体
采样器设置:提供独立采样、多重抖动采样等多种采样方式根据场景复杂度和渲染质量要求选择合适的采样器,平衡渲染速度与效果
积分器选择:包含路径追踪、瞬态渲染等多种积分器路径追踪适用于大多数场景,瞬态渲染可用于模拟动态光影效果
滤镜选项:有高斯滤镜、帐篷滤镜等多种滤镜用于调整渲染图像的抗锯齿效果和细节表现

6. 常见故障排除流程图

7. 进阶实战教程:自定义材质开发

目标:通过修改相关文件扩展插件的材质支持,创建自定义材质。操作

  1. 找到插件安装目录下的io/exporter/materials.py文件,这个文件负责材质的导出逻辑。
  2. 使用文本编辑器打开该文件,了解现有材质的定义和导出方式。
  3. 根据自己的需求,添加新的材质类或修改现有材质的参数。例如,添加一种具有特殊光泽效果的材质,定义其物理属性和渲染参数。
  4. 保存修改后的文件,重启Blender使更改生效。
  5. 在Blender中创建一个物体,应用自定义的材质,进行渲染测试,根据结果调整材质参数。预期结果:成功创建自定义材质,并能在渲染中正确显示其效果。

相关工具推荐

  • Blender Cycles渲染器:Blender自带的强大渲染器,适合快速预览和基础渲染需求。
  • LuxCoreRender:另一款高质量的物理渲染引擎,与Blender有良好的集成,可作为Mitsuba的替代选择。
  • Octane Render:一款GPU加速的渲染器,以其快速的渲染速度和出色的效果受到很多设计师的喜爱。

通过以上7个关键环节的学习,相信你已经对Mitsuba Blender插件有了深入的了解,并能熟练运用它来提升你的3D作品渲染质量。不断实践和探索,你会发现更多Mitsuba渲染器的强大之处,创作出更加惊艳的3D作品!Happy Rendering! 🎨

【免费下载链接】mitsuba-blenderMitsuba integration add-on for Blender项目地址: https://gitcode.com/gh_mirrors/mi/mitsuba-blender

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 22:16:11

解锁macOS跨平台潜能:Whisky完全使用指南

解锁macOS跨平台潜能:Whisky完全使用指南 【免费下载链接】Whisky A modern Wine wrapper for macOS built with SwiftUI 项目地址: https://gitcode.com/gh_mirrors/wh/Whisky 在苹果生态中无缝运行Windows程序不再是梦想!Whisky作为一款基于Swi…

作者头像 李华
网站建设 2026/4/23 10:33:08

如何实现跨平台音乐API集成:从功能到部署的全流程指南

如何实现跨平台音乐API集成:从功能到部署的全流程指南 【免费下载链接】music-api 各大音乐平台的歌曲播放地址获取接口,包含网易云音乐,qq音乐,酷狗音乐等平台 项目地址: https://gitcode.com/gh_mirrors/mu/music-api 1.…

作者头像 李华
网站建设 2026/4/23 11:21:27

Paraformer-large支持英文吗?中英混合识别实战测试

Paraformer-large支持英文吗?中英混合识别实战测试 1. 这个镜像到底能干啥? 先说结论:Paraformer-large 离线版不仅能识别英文,还能准确处理中英混合语音——但不是靠“猜”,而是模型本身设计就支持双语能力。很多用…

作者头像 李华
网站建设 2026/4/17 19:33:14

3个核心技巧:Anno 1800 Mod Loader完全掌握指南

3个核心技巧:Anno 1800 Mod Loader完全掌握指南 【免费下载链接】anno1800-mod-loader The one and only mod loader for Anno 1800, supports loading of unpacked RDA files, XML merging and Python mods. 项目地址: https://gitcode.com/gh_mirrors/an/anno18…

作者头像 李华
网站建设 2026/4/23 12:32:12

解锁Blender渲染新可能:5个步骤掌握Mitsuba渲染器插件

解锁Blender渲染新可能:5个步骤掌握Mitsuba渲染器插件 【免费下载链接】mitsuba-blender Mitsuba integration add-on for Blender 项目地址: https://gitcode.com/gh_mirrors/mi/mitsuba-blender Blender作为开源3D创作软件,其内置渲染引擎在复杂…

作者头像 李华
网站建设 2026/4/14 5:10:17

如何用3个步骤在Linux系统上运行Android应用?Waydroid全攻略

如何用3个步骤在Linux系统上运行Android应用?Waydroid全攻略 【免费下载链接】waydroid Waydroid uses a container-based approach to boot a full Android system on a regular GNU/Linux system like Ubuntu. 项目地址: https://gitcode.com/gh_mirrors/wa/way…

作者头像 李华